What is alternative verdict?



Alternative Verdict is a verdict of not guilty of the offence actually charged, but guilt of some lesser offence not specifically charged. Alternative verdict is only permitted where there is insufficient evidence to establish more serious offence but the evidence given is sufficient to prove a lesser offence. It is governed by section 305 of Criminal Procedure Act and it arises where is charged with offence under sections 294 – 298 of the Penal Code but, is not found guilty with offence charged but that he is guilty with any other offence under the said sections.
